Route Description

Everything you need to know about the corridor Dangriga - Atlanta

The logistics corridor connecting Dangriga, Belize to Atlanta, Georgia represents a vital cross-border trade route spanning approximately 1,906 kilometers through Central America and into the southeastern United States. This corridor serves as a crucial link between the Caribbean and North American markets, facilitating the movement of diverse cargo types including agricultural products, manufactured goods, and consumer merchandise. The route traverses multiple countries and requires seamless coordination across international borders, making it an ideal application for our specialized cross-border freight solutions.

The economic significance of this corridor is substantial, connecting Belize's growing export sector with Atlanta's position as a major logistics hub in the southeastern United States. Atlanta's Hartsfield-Jackson International Airport and extensive rail network make it a gateway for goods distribution throughout the region. The corridor supports industries such as automotive parts, electronics, pharmaceuticals, and perishable goods, with businesses relying on efficient transportation to maintain competitive supply chains between these strategic locations.

Transportation infrastructure along this route includes major highways such as the Carretera del Atlántico in Belize, connecting roads through Guatemala, and the Interstate highway system in the United States. Key border crossings at the Belize-Guatemala border and subsequent points require careful coordination and documentation. Dangriga Origin

Dangriga

Stann Creek, Belize

Dangriga, located in the Stann Creek District of Belize, serves as an important coastal logistics center with access to both maritime and ground transportation networks. The city's strategic position on the Caribbean coast provides connections to international shipping routes, while its proximity to major highways facilitates efficient inland distribution. Dangriga's port facilities handle various cargo types, supporting the region's agricultural exports including bananas, citrus fruits, and marine products that require reliable transportation to North American markets.

The economic base of Dangriga includes fishing, agriculture, and emerging manufacturing sectors. The city's location makes it particularly suitable for businesses involved in export-oriented operations, with several industrial parks and commercial zones supporting logistics activities. Transportation infrastructure includes the Philip Goldson Highway connecting to Belize City and onward to the Guatemalan border, providing essential links for cross-border freight movement. The availability of both refrigerated and standard warehousing facilities in the area supports diverse cargo handling requirements for businesses utilizing this corridor.

Atlanta Destination

Atlanta, Georgia stands as one of the most significant logistics hubs in the United States, offering unparalleled connectivity through its multimodal transportation infrastructure. The city's strategic location in the southeastern region provides access to major interstate highways including I-75, I-85, and I-20, creating efficient distribution networks throughout the eastern United States. Atlanta's Hartsfield-Jackson International Airport, the world's busiest by passenger traffic, also serves as a major cargo hub, while the city's extensive rail connections through Norfolk Southern and CSX Transportation provide additional freight options.

The economic landscape of Atlanta encompasses diverse industries including automotive manufacturing, aerospace, technology, healthcare, and consumer goods distribution. The city hosts numerous Fortune 500 company headquarters and serves as a regional distribution center for major retailers. Atlanta's robust logistics infrastructure includes multiple warehousing and distribution centers, specialized handling facilities for temperature-sensitive cargo, and advanced customs clearance services. The city's Foreign Trade Zone status provides additional advantages for international businesses, making it an ideal destination for cross-border freight operations connecting Central American markets with the broader North American supply chain.
